A.D. 1061 x 1066. King Edward to Peterborough Abbey; confirmation of an agreement concerning land at Scotton, Scotter and Manton, Lincs., acquired by the monk Brand and leased by him to his brother Askytel, with reversion after his death to Peterborough Abbey (when an estate at Northorpe, Lincs., is to be substituted for Manton). Latin

Archive:

Peterborough

MSS:

1. London, British Library, Egerton 2733, ff. 31v-33v (s. xiii med.)
2. London, Society of Antiquaries, 60, f. 26r-v (s. xii med.)
3. Peterborough, DC., 1, f. 109r (s. xiii med.)
4. Peterborough, DC., 5, f. 20r (s. xiii med.)

Printed:

K, 819; Pierquin, Recueil, pt 6, no. 42

Comments:

Stenton 1924, p. xli; Oleson 1955, p. 154, authentic; Lennard 1959, pp. 167-9, on background; Hart, ECEE, no. 159, not authentic, but transaction probably has a genuine basis; Sawyer 1998, p. 234
